Runs consistently in production and supports reliable backend infrastructure workflows
Compared to any other offering in the Linux world, to me personally, Ubuntu 24.04 LTS - Noble (Arm) is quite similar and doesn't really matter; it usually just works. The differences are usually in support and the Ubuntu Pro plan, which I do not have, but the same applies with Red Hat—you can run it free of charge, but then you lack the support, which is what I do with Ubuntu 24.04 LTS - Noble (Arm) as well, so it runs the same as any other Linux distro. In terms of stability and reliability, I've had none worth mentioning or caused by something that wasn't in my own hands, so that's been fine so far. In my team, I have about seven people managing about 60 to 70 VMs across four different clusters and about 16 nodes. I spread them out very evenly and very thinly. User-wise, I don't really serve a company internally; I sell my service on the open market. I have no idea on the numbers of how many customers I have, but it's in the several thousands that use the machines or the service I host through my infrastructure.

Collaborative development has become more secure and efficient for our team
We have faced some issues with Windows OneDrive because if one developer has a folder in a common OneDrive folder, it took some time to show it to others. It becomes somewhat difficult to work, as there is latency on that, so if you update that, it will be more efficient and useful for the developers. My main focus on Windows 10 is the giving of regular updates, so it might take some time to update Windows, which is also mandatory. As a developer, when we are working with Windows 10, if it takes more time to update and restart the PC, it affects our efficiency at work. If we could stop the updates on a regular basis or if they were delivered faster, it would be easier. As a developer, the frequent updates are too annoying for working on it, so it would be better if we stop the frequent updates and only provide the most important ones. Performance issues over time due to background apps and programs piling up and using an SSD instead of a hard disk are also concerns.
